Transitioning From Casual to Corporate: Building a Business-Ready Wardrobe
Navigating a transition from casual attire to corporate dress can feel like a daunting task. It's crucial to curate your wardrobe that projects confidence while adhering to office norms. Begin by acquiring foundational pieces like tailored blazers, crisp shirts, and well-fitting trousers. Choose sophisticated colors such as black, navy, gray, and white as a base, then incorporate pops of color with accessories or statement pieces. Remember, it's about striking the balance between style and professionalism.
- Reflect on your workplace atmosphere to figure out the appropriate level of formality.
- Prioritize quality over quantity. Well-made garments will last longer and look more polished.
- Enhance your outfits with appropriate jewelry, a watch, or a scarf to add a individual touch.
By following these tips, you can develop a business-ready wardrobe that makes your feel confident and ready to thrive in the corporate world.

Business Dress for Every Occasion: A Comprehensive Guide
Navigating the world of professional attire can be difficult, especially when faced with various situations. From business meetings to networking events, understanding the appropriate dress code is crucial for making a good impression. This detailed guide will help you decode professional attire for every occasion, ensuring you always look and feel your best.
- Begin with the basics: A well-fitted suit in a neutral color is a versatile choice for formal settings. Pair it with a crisp shirt or blouse and classic shoes.
- Think about the industry: Creative fields may allow for more relaxed dress codes, while finance or law tend to be more conservative.
- Accessorize your outfit with understated jewelry and a professional handbag.
